Output d0eb5585ec759bedfa1535e0801db363351abd44caaebdccbe370712ca01ab1a:0

value
1977659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25dc9b30ad59c5966abcab69822a895af16f2045 OP_EQUAL
address
359DCdUooKswe4jyQJwoqcFhdBbTtFS6aX
transaction
d0eb5585ec759bedfa1535e0801db363351abd44caaebdccbe370712ca01ab1a
confirmations
159232
spent
true